Enhancing math skills, particularly addition and subtraction, for children aged 4-7 is crucial for several substantial reasons. At this developmental stage, children's brains are especially receptive to learning new concepts, making it an ideal time to establish a strong foundation in mathematics. Early exposure to addition and subtraction helps cultivate logical thinking and problem-solving skills, which are critical for academic success in later years.
When children learn these basic arithmetic skills early on, they gain confidence in their ability to tackle more complex mathematical concepts in the future. This foundational knowledge also integrates into their daily lives, enabling them to understand quantity, manage resources, and make decisions based on numerical information. Furthermore, early mathematical skills have been shown to correlate with better performance not only in math-related subjects but across the academic board, including reading and writing, as they enhance cognitive development and analytical reasoning.
Parents and teachers play a pivotal role in creating an engaging and supportive environment for learning these skills. By incorporating fun activities and real-life applications, they can foster a positive attitude towards mathematics, making the learning process enjoyable and relevant. Ultimately, investing in early math education equips children with the tools necessary for lifelong learning and everyday problem-solving, giving them a solid basis from which to grow and succeed.
